What Is Bone Density?
Bone density refers to the quantity of mineral web content in your bones, particularly calcium and phosphorus, which identifies their toughness and structure. Healthy and balanced bone density is critical for total bone wellness, as it aids protect against fractures and supports your body's various functions. When your bone thickness is optimal, your bones can stand up to everyday anxieties and strains without breaking.
As you age, your bone density normally lowers, specifically in women post-menopause. This decrease can result in conditions like osteoporosis, making bones extra breakable and at risk to injury.
To maintain or enhance your bone density, you've reached focus on your way of living options. Normal weight-bearing workouts, a well balanced diet abundant in calcium and vitamin D, and staying clear of smoking and excessive alcohol usage can all add substantially.
Obtaining normal bone thickness screenings can likewise aid you track adjustments gradually. If you notice a decrease, your healthcare provider can suggest treatments, such as dietary modifications or medicines, to help preserve your bone wellness.
Influence On Oral Implants
Sufficient bone density is important for the success of oral implants. When you undergo a dental implant treatment, the implant needs to integrate with your jawbone, offering stability and toughness. If your bone thickness wants, the implant may not fuse appropriately, causing difficulties like dental implant failing. You desire a durable foundation for your dental implant, and low bone density can compromise that.

If the bone isn't thick enough to support the dental implant, your dental practitioner may've to position it in a much less ideal placement, which can lead to imbalance and discomfort. This can impact your ability to chew and speak efficiently.
Furthermore, reduced bone thickness can increase the risk of infection around the dental implant site. Without solid bone support, the body might battle to heal appropriately, and that can cause problems better down the line.
Eventually, guaranteeing you have sufficient bone density not only improves the immediate success of your dental implant yet additionally enhances your long-term oral wellness and performance. So, prior to waging implants, it's essential to analyze your bone density and review any kind of concerns with your dentist.
Solutions for Reduced Bone Density
If you're facing low bone density and thinking about dental implants, there are numerous effective remedies to discover.
First, your dental expert might recommend bone grafting, where they use bone product from another part of your body or a donor to rebuild the bone framework in your jaw. This treatment can produce a more powerful structure for your implants.

You might additionally explore the possibility of using growth variables or bone-stimulating medications. These therapies can encourage your body to regrow bone tissue and boost density in time.
Lastly, way of life adjustments-- like increased calcium and vitamin D intake, regular workout, and quitting smoking cigarettes-- can also reinforce your bones.
Before making any type of choices, consult your dental expert or dental surgeon to discuss the very best remedies tailored to your situation. Together, you can determine the most effective course forward for an effective dental implant procedure.
